Both industrial drum fans and box fans serve the purpose of providing airflow and cooling. However, they function in different environments and have unique design characteristics. Understanding these differences helps in making an informed choice.
An industrial drum fan is typically large and powerful. It consists of a sturdy cylindrical housing that contains a large fan blade. These fans are designed for industrial settings, such as warehouses, factories, and large outdoor areas. Their main advantage lies in their ability to move a substantial amount of air quickly.
A box fan is smaller and more portable compared to an industrial drum fan. It usually consists of a square or rectangular frame with a fan mounted inside. Box fans are ideal for residential use and can easily be moved from room to room. They are well-suited for smaller spaces where targeted airflow is needed.
The industrial drum fan excels in airflow and coverage. It can circulate air over large areas effectively. This makes it perfect for cooling vast spaces like factories or outdoor gatherings. On the other hand, while box fans can provide decent airflow, they are limited in their coverage area.
When it comes to speed and performance, the industrial drum fan shines. It can usually operate at higher RPMs, resulting in a more robust airflow. This means it can cool down an area more rapidly than a box fan. However, box fans have their merits too. They often come with multiple speed settings, allowing users to adjust airflow according to their needs.
In terms of energy consumption, box fans tend to be more efficient. They require less power to operate, making them suitable for home use. Moreover, sporadic use of a box fan can help cut down on electricity bills.

Industrial drum fans, while generally more powerful, may consume more energy. However, they are built for durability and longevity. They can withstand harsh conditions and require less frequent replacement. Keeping them well-maintained ensures they last for years.
Box fans are typically quieter than industrial drum fans. Their design allows for a more peaceful ambiance, making them great for bedrooms and study spaces. Industrial drum fans may generate more noise due to their powerful motors, which might not be ideal for quieter environments.
However, if you're cooling a large area, noise might not be a concern. The industrial drum fan can overpower background noise in bustling industrial settings. Users tend to tolerate higher sound levels when work is in progress.
Choosing between an industrial drum fan and a box fan depends on your specific needs. If you require high airflow and are cooling large spaces, the industrial drum fan is your best bet. Its strength and efficiency can create a comfortable environment in almost any industrial setting.
Alternatively, if you need a portable option for home use, go for the box fan. It’s energy-efficient and quieter, making it suitable for bedrooms, offices, or small living areas.
